HC Deb 07 November 1939 vol 353 cc64-5W
Captain Strickland

asked the Secretary of State for War at what rates payment is made for hire of road motor goods-vehicles requisitioned by his Department; what are the periods of payment; and to what date full payment has already been made?

Mr. Hore-Belisha

No vehicles have been requisitioned for hire by the War Department.

Captain Strickland

asked the Secretary of State for War at what rates payment is made for hire of road motor goods-vehicles by his Department; what are the periods of payment; and to what date full payment has already been issued?

Mr. Hore-Belisha

Hiring of road transport vehicles is arranged by Army Commands at rates agreed with each individual contractor. Agreements provide for bills to be paid monthly or on completion of the service, if this is of shorter duration. Instructions have been issued that in cases where it has been impracticable to arrive at agreed rates, substantial advances should be made pending final settlement. In cases where rates cannot be agreed, provision is made for recourse to arbitration.

The answer to the last part of the question could not be given without a large number of separate inquiries.
